Obituary: ​Benjamin C. Rhodes, 74, Longtime Oyster Bay Resident

He was an entrepreneur who dabbled in many different fields over the years. However, his family was his greatest accomplishment.

Benjamin C. Rhodes, husband of the late Dorothy “Dodie” Rhodes, passed away on Saturday, June 16 at the age of 74.

Ben was born on September 27th, 1943 to Benjamin D. Rhodes and Marguerite Rhodes. He was a long time resident of Oyster Bay and an entrepreneur who dabbled in many different fields over the years. He spent 27 years in the towing business, but also worked as a mechanic, ran a bar, owned a slot car track, a vending route, and a mail-order billiards company. His interests were vast and he often said that if a business venture stopped being fun, he simply did something else.

Of all of his many accomplishments, he felt that his family was his greatest. He leaves behind three daughters- Noreen Cassidy (Jon), Marguerite “Beth” DeLeo (Richard), and Jennifer Zoffranieri (Adam), five granddaughters- Kimberly, Tara, Jessica, Kayla, and Kelly, and three great-grandchildren.

Family will receive friends at the Francis P. DeVine Funeral Home at 293 South Street,Oyster Bay on June 20, 2018 from 2-4pm and 7-9pm. In lieu of flowers, donations can be made to the First Presbyterian Church of Oyster Bay,60 East Main Street.
